Accommodations: Two-bedroom, mid-century cabin, all original details well preserved, very comfortable. 1 queen-sized, 1 king-sized beds sleeps 2-4. Upstairs bedroom is a loft. Newly remodeled bathroom with shower, heated floors, towel warmer. Brand new heaters. Fully stocked kitchen featuring Sven Ceramics . Additional accommodations courtesy of a 16’ Airstream with its own bathroom, sleeps 1 adult comfortably and 2 cozily. Dry heat sauna with outdoor shower, next to the cabin seats 2-4 people.
Fireplace: Typically, we allow guests to use the fireplace from October to April depending on fire hazard issues posted by the local fire department.
Property is not suited for children under 8 years old. No animals.
3 night minimum stay, occasional 2 night stay pending availability.
Where: 10 minutes from the ocean, 15 minutes to Guerneville, close to many Russian River wineries.
Bodega Bay/Jenner - dramatic ocean views, bird watching, whale spotting, rugged NorCal beaches and good selection of dining.
Guerneville / Monte Rio / Duncan Mills – river rafting, summer music festivals, restaurants, bars, bakeries, groceries, and best taco truck around.
Russian River Area – wine tasting, pastoral valleys, restaurants hiking, and biking.
